LONGITUDE is a riveting scientific adventure set against the backdrop of the Age of Exploration, detailing the pressing challenge of determining longitude at sea. As sailors faced perilous conditions without accurate navigation, England's Parliament in 1714 offered a substantial reward for a reliable solution. While the scientific community leaned towards celestial methods, John Harrison proposed a groundbreaking mechanical clock capable of maintaining precise time at sea, igniting a remarkable race for innovation. This captivating audiobook weaves together themes of heroism, chicanery, and the rich history of astronomy, navigation, and clockmaking.
